scholarly journals Effect of Microbial (Jeevatu) Treatment on Rice (Oryza sativa L.) Production

JeevatuTM is a consortium of beneficial natural microbes, available in liquid form. The yield of rice was observed vigorously high in Jeevatu based rice cultivated plant. The seed production in per spikelet is 237.1±44.92 in Jeevatu based and 179.4±25.26 in chemical based rice plant.  In case of vegetative growth, 173.1±6.34 cm and 140.9±11.11 cm in Jeevatu based rice plant and chemical based methods respectively. Similarly the length of stalk of spikelet is 27±1.63cm and 22.1±2.23 cm was observed in Jeevatu based and chemical based respectively. The number of stalk in lumps is 16.2±1.75 and 12.2±2.20 in Jeevatu and chemical based paddy plant respectively under the same environment and physical factors.DOI: http://dx.doi.org/10.3126/ijasbt.v1i4.9134 Int J Appl Sci Biotechnol, Vol. 1(4): 184-188
